		<description><![CDATA[Tweet The RX8 is a great performance car out of the box. The car is a direct competitor in its class of nimble and balanced track ready street cars. This class includes the likes of the Lotus Exige, the Honda S2000, and the Mazda Miata. These cars typically boast there nimble handling, great engine response, balanced front to rear 50/50 weight distribution, and great driving feel. The RX8 adds to that list of specs with some unique parts such as a factory equipped carbon fiber driveshaft, and a torque sensing limited slip differential to increase the utilization of and transmittance of crank horsepower into the pavement. With this kind of approach, you&#8217;d think that the car is originally underpowered and that Mazda is trying to milk every ounce of hp out of it&#8217;s drive-train but that&#8217;s far from true. 232hp @ 8500 rpms with a 9000 rpm redline and a wide powerband of 3000 rpms between peak torque and peak power. The engine is also an internationally acclaimed motor of the year as far back as year 2003 when it first came on the scene. 		<description><![CDATA[Tweet The Lysholm / Autorotor Supercharger is a unique and very practical chager. The unit is a great compromize between a positive displacement supercharger (that creates boost pressure by over pumping and over feeding the engine with air) and a compressor (similar to a turbocharger) that compresses the air inside the supercharger housing before sending it out to the charger piping. The unique three-five design of the twin screw chargers relies on a 3 lobe and a 5 lobe rotor intermeshed to capture the air flowing into the supercharger for inter-screw compression. The combination of an intermeshed 3 lobe and 5 lobe rotor means that the rotors inside the housing are operating at different rpms with a ratio of 5:3 to keep the rotation of the lobes (3 lobes to 5) in synchronsim. This complex design allows the rotors to capture air (in its natural volume) from the back of the blower housing, and push it foward as the screws rotate. 		<description><![CDATA[Tweet Building on the beautiful high revving v8 powerplant, MTM motorsports upgrades the performance, looks, styling, and handling of the 4.2 Audi RS4. The heart of the upgrade package is a Lysholm twin screw compressor elevating intake pressures to a modest 6 psi. This fairly low boost pressure means that the engine&#8217;s static compression ration can be left untouched and that the supercharger package can be a true &#8216;bolt on&#8217; affair. Following through with this &#8216;bolt on&#8217; strategy, MTM have coupled the supercharger with an integrated top mount intake manifold with integrated air to water intercooler courtesy of Laminova intercoolers. Also in the mix is an MTM bolt-on cat-back exhaust system exiting in an exotic dual dual (that&#8217;s four outlets) 3&#8243; tips. The car is further enhanced with suspension modifications, lowering, lightweight body parts rounding off the performance package.  The result of all of this work is shifting power up from 420 hp @ 7800 rpms to 540 hp @ 8220 rpms. Torque is amplified from an original 317 ft lb , 430 Nm @ 6000 rpm to a new 412 ft lbs, 560 Nm @ 3700 rpms. 		<description><![CDATA[Tweet If you’re a car geek like myself, then some cars (although modestly powered) will still interest you because of the sheer amount of theory and technology jammed into them. One such car is the mid 90s to early 20s Mazda 929S (AKA the millennia, the Sentia). The car is powered by a small but very efficient Miller Cycle 2.3 liter 60* V6. The engine utilizes the miller combustion cycle in which the horsepower losses associated with the first half of the compression stroke (when the piston is much closer to bottom dead center), by keeping the intake valve open. Obviously on a typical 4 stroke motor the open valve would allow the air from the previous stroke (the intake stroke) to escape causing a loss in power, but in the miller cycle the air stays trapped in the cylinder and is rather compressed to 2.0 atmospheres due to a roots type supercharger boosting the engine to 14.0 psi. Once the piston rises up in the cylinder bore to a more efficient location, the valve is closed and the piston completes the compression stroke on its own.
